Is Sports Betting Legal in Pennsylvania?

Yes, sports betting is fully legal in Pennsylvania. The market has been regulated by the Pennsylvania Gaming Control Board (PGCB) since its inception. Retail sports betting began in November 2018, with online sportsbooks launching in May 2019. As of August 2025, about 11 licensed online sportsbooks are in operation.

Quick Legal Timeline

  • 2017: Legislation authorized sports betting.
  • November 2018: First retail sportsbook opens.
  • May 2019: First online book becomes active.

What You Can’t Bet on in Pennsylvania

While the betting market is expansive, certain restrictions remain, ensuring integrity and compliance with state regulations.

Restricted Markets

  • Entertainment & Political Markets: Betting on Oscars, elections, or reality TV outcomes is prohibited.
  • High School Sports: All types of betting on high school events are disallowed.

Pennsylvania Sports Betting Handle

The betting handle for a given period encapsulates the total amount wagered with sportsbooks. Understanding how the handle is calculated helps bettors grasp the betting landscape.

Historical Betting Handle

Year Betting Handle
2019 $1,490,167,111
2020 $3,580,864,477
2021 $6,552,109,118
2022 $7,251,428,758
2023 $7,683,099,581
2024 $8,421,417,830

Responsible Gaming in Pennsylvania

Pennsylvania provides several resources for bettors to ensure a safe gaming experience. The PA Problem Gambling Helpline (1-800-GAMBLER) and the Pennsylvania Gaming Control Board offer support and resources for managing gambling-related issues.

Tools Offered by Sportsbooks

  • Deposit & Loss Limits: Set caps on spending.
  • Timeouts: Temporarily restrict access for breaks.
  • Self-Exclusion Programs: Voluntarily ban oneself from gambling activities.

Voluntary Exclusion Program

Managed by the PGCB, this program allows players to exclude themselves from casinos and online platforms.
